The University of Georgia football team is commonly referred to as the "Bulldogs." This nickname was officially adopted in 1920, but the origins of the nickname date back to the late 19th century when a fan described the team as playing with the "fighting spirit of a bulldog."

Since then, the Bulldogs have become synonymous with grit, determination, and tenacity on the football field. They have a rich history of success, with multiple conference championships and national titles to their name. The team's mascot, Uga, is a live bulldog that has become a beloved symbol of the University of Georgia.

On game days, fans can be heard cheering on the Bulldogs with chants of "Go Dawgs!" and waving the team's signature red and black colors. The team's logo, which features a snarling bulldog, is instantly recognizable to college football fans across the country.

The Bulldogs compete in the Southeastern Conference (SEC), one of the most competitive conferences in college football. Their fierce rivalry with the University of Florida Gators, known as the "World's Largest Outdoor Cocktail Party," is one of the most anticipated matchups of the season.

Over the years, the Bulldogs have produced numerous NFL players and Hall of Famers, further solidifying their reputation as a powerhouse program. Their success on the field has also translated to success off the field, with the team consistently ranking among the top in the nation in terms of attendance and revenue.

Whether you're a die-hard fan or a casual observer, it's hard to deny the impact that the Georgia Bulldogs have had on the world of college football. Their tradition of excellence, combined with their iconic nickname and mascot, make them a truly special team to watch and support.
